iOS 17.2 Beta 4: The latest features at a glance

First of all, it's important to know that Apple has almost completed development of iOS 17.2 and the update is expected to be released in December. As we approach the end of the beta testing phase, Apple continues to work on improving features and fixing bugs.

The highlights of iOS 17.2 Beta 4

This update promises to take the user experience on iPhones and iPads to the next level. Let's get started right away!

  • Default notification sound: There is a brand new section under Sounds & Haptics called Default Notifications. Here you have the option to customize the sound for all incoming notifications. Previously this was only possible for SMS, mail and calendar notifications. The good news is that you can now use all available text tones as your default notification sound. Additionally, you can customize the haptic vibration for default notifications to your liking to create a personalized notification experience.
  • Shared Apple Music Playlists: An interesting feature introduced in an earlier version of iOS 17.2 was the ability to share Apple Music playlists with others. Unfortunately, Apple temporarily removed this option in the fourth beta version. However, it remains to be seen if it will return by the time the final version of iOS 17.2 is released.
  • AppleCare Settings: The settings for AppleCare have been redesigned in iOS 17.2 Beta 4. The "Coverage" section under "Settings" > "General" has been renamed "AppleCare & Warranty". Here you will still find all important information about AppleCare, both for your iPhone and connected devices such as Apple Watch and AirPods. There is also now a new section under "General" > "About" called "Warranty" that provides you with detailed information about your iPhone's warranty. These changes are intended to help you manage your Apple devices even easier.
  • Recording to an external storage device: An exciting new feature concerns owners of the iPhone 15 Pro models. With these devices, you can now record ProRes videos directly to an external storage device. iOS 17.2 has added a new pop-up message that warns you that external recording may not work due to a USB-C cable that is too slow. Previously, there was only a warning about the write speed of the external storage device, but now the speed of the USB-C cable is also taken into account.
  • iTunes: A notable change has been discovered in the code of iOS 17.2. Apple apparently plans to remove the option to purchase TV shows and movies in the iTunes app. Instead, TV and movie content will be available exclusively in the TV app. However, it is important to stress that this change has not yet been implemented. The code states: "You can buy or rent TV shows and find your purchases in the Apple TV app."
